fiddler抓包APP
2018-12-07 本文已影响0人
钟微
环境准备:
1、电脑上安装fiddler
2、手机和电脑在同一个局域网
一、设置
1.fiddler>Tools>Options>Connections 勾选Allow remote computers to connect。(允许远程连接计算机)
2.记住这里的端口号:8888,后面会用到。
![](https://img.haomeiwen.com/i2014194/6b776df0b5f0e840.png)
二、查看电脑IP
![](https://img.haomeiwen.com/i2014194/a941e9b6ee0dc383.png)
三、设置手机代理
1、手机设置——》WLAN——》点击WiFi后面的>按钮——》设置代理
![](https://img.haomeiwen.com/i2014194/39ae8981801f9d2c.png)
四、抓取手机上HTTPS请求
1、如果手机上都是http请求,不需要安装证书,能够直接抓到,如果是HTTPS的请求,手机就需要下载证书
2、打开手机浏览器输入:http://电脑IP地址:8888,进行下载安装
![](https://img.haomeiwen.com/i2014194/18ad3ff759f2ee48.png)
五、设置过滤
1、手机上设置代理后,这时候fiddler上抓到的是PC和APP的所有请求,会很多,这时候就需要开启过滤功能
2、打开fiddler>Tools>Options>HTTPS>...from remote clients only,勾选这个选项就可以了
...from all processes :抓所有的请求
...from browsers only :只抓浏览器的请求
...from non-browsers only :只抓非浏览器的请求
...from remote clients only:只抓远程客户端请求
![](https://img.haomeiwen.com/i2014194/d39b401fde9d576f.png)
六、根据域名过滤抓包内容
![](https://img.haomeiwen.com/i2014194/6234ca7388173400.png)
七、清空抓的包
![](https://img.haomeiwen.com/i2014194/39a4ea370b44fff3.png)
八、抓包数据中各种图标的意义
![](https://img.haomeiwen.com/i2014194/e8efff9c443543cc.png)
![](https://img.haomeiwen.com/i2014194/a7e4e6d4c925634c.png)
参考文献:https://www.cnblogs.com/starstarstar/p/8868604.html